Akbar Hotel

New Delhi
1967-69

Post-tensioned shallow girders of 18m span carry the upper ten-floors of this 300 room hotel leaving the lower public areas column free. Tapering ribs radiate out of columns to span 18m at the entrance lobby level.

Architect: Shiv Nath Prasad
Design Engineer: D S Parikh

Maurya Hotel

New Delhi
1975-77

Four wings connected to a central core accomodate 350 rooms in this five-star hotel. Each wing has cascading landscaped terraces. Post-tensioned vierendeel trusses spanning 15m carry the upper floors. Precast trussed planks and hollow blocks have been used to cast the main floors to effect economy in material and to reduce substantially the construction time. The front basement of the hotel houses a multipurpose hall measuring 30m x 30m having a double layer space grid in structural steel designed for a landscaped earthfil to provide a lawn.

Architect: Rajinder Kumar
Design Engineers: B B Chaudhuri GD Juneja I C Gupta C M Sardana
Associate Engineer: H S Bakshi
